Transaction 6c581e914734588c62a9dac6170336341b638264832ca774e01c4583fa180862
1 Input
1 Output
-
6c581e914734588c62a9dac6170336341b638264832ca774e01c4583fa180862:0
- value
- 42573
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6115797ded01a06e24585dc9292bc00b432e9e52 OP_EQUAL
- address
- 3AYMCEMkVAdyWGc43f1oYcoeBNXcKW1Dia